Beth Eriksen Shoup: Why I Am Voting For Sky White

We believe Diversity & Inclusion needs a seat at the table and voting for Sky U. White for County Commissioner District 7 (countywide) will bring that representation!!

Hillsborough County is Florida’s 4th most populous county with an estimated 1.3 million residents as of 2015 and a median age of 36 years. Our county is rich in culture with residents from various backgrounds and ethnicities. Unfortunately, our elected officials do not reflect the diversity of the people who reside in Hillsborough County, nor do they reflect the median age group.

While age is often aligned with experience, it can also contribute to stagnated policies and worn-out traditions that no longer serve our best interests. Change is inherent to progress, and in order to implement change, we need diversity and fresh perspectives among our policy makers. An increase in diversity not only decreases racial bias among those in positions of power, but it will also ensure that our up and coming generations are represented by those who can relate to the issues that affect them most.

Hillsborough County deserves to have more people of color, more women, and more individuals from other diverse and under-represented communities in key leadership positions to serve the community. Sky will be the first African-American to be elected to a countywide Commissioner seat, and she will fight to ensure representation of a diverse and progressive county that cares about the success and rights of all its residents.
